Output 9268bf3859058131511f5418454e57a1cfd6365d43e2b5c5226b5f6047910560:0

value
33829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cde5716c201901a3d8a507fcf838805cfaa8aa OP_EQUAL
address
3HMS8GbyeKxFGx1U6WccgzA3KmAWWrYquA
transaction
9268bf3859058131511f5418454e57a1cfd6365d43e2b5c5226b5f6047910560
spent
true